Foros del Web » Programando para Internet » PHP »

como puedo hacer un reporte!!

Estas en el tema de como puedo hacer un reporte!! en el foro de PHP en Foros del Web. Buen dia masters !!! . . pues tengo un proyecto para hacer unas validaciones solo quiero saber si con PHP, puedo hacer un reporte de ...
  #1 (permalink)  
Antiguo 28/03/2014, 20:20
 
Fecha de Ingreso: marzo-2014
Mensajes: 66
Antigüedad: 10 años, 1 mes
Puntos: 0
como puedo hacer un reporte!!

Buen dia masters !!!
.
.
pues tengo un proyecto para hacer unas validaciones solo quiero saber si con PHP, puedo hacer un reporte de tales datos de mi base de datos, estos vendran de los datos de consulta que meta el usuario y hacerlo apto para imprimir, o que se pueda mostrar como pdf o algo asi.
.
.
Gracias y saludos a todos!!
  #2 (permalink)  
Antiguo 28/03/2014, 20:26
 
Fecha de Ingreso: junio-2013
Ubicación: En cualquier parte de mi casa
Mensajes: 139
Antigüedad: 10 años, 10 meses
Puntos: 14
Respuesta: como puedo hacer un reporte!!

Por supuesto se puede hacer!..Puedes hacerlo que se genere como PDF o puedes imprimirlo directamente con javascript(Mas facil)
  #3 (permalink)  
Antiguo 29/03/2014, 08:53
Avatar de jheckson  
Fecha de Ingreso: febrero-2011
Ubicación: $VE->Aragua['Maracay']
Mensajes: 109
Antigüedad: 13 años, 2 meses
Puntos: 8
Respuesta: como puedo hacer un reporte!!

Ps te recomendaria usar Dompdf, es muy buena, te transforma tu codigo html (con css e images incluso, aunque con pequeños fallos) en un PDF el cual puedes guardar en tu proyecto o mandar al navegador para descargarlo.

Busca la libreria, guarda su codigo en tu proyecto y de esta manera puedes utilizarla:

Código PHP:
Ver original
  1. # Cargamos la librería dompdf.
  2. require_once 'dompdf/dompdf_config.inc.php';
  3.  
  4.  
  5.         function cargarDocumento($html)
  6.         {
  7.         # Instanciamos un objeto de la clase DOMPDF.
  8.         $mipdf = new DOMPDF();
  9.          
  10.         # Definimos el tamaño y orientación del papel que queremos.
  11.         # O por defecto cogerá el que está en el fichero de configuración.
  12.         //$mipdf ->set_paper("A4", "portrait");
  13.          
  14.         # Cargamos el contenido HTML. (la variable $html tiene que tener el codigo HTML
  15.                #que queires mandar a mostrar)
  16.  
  17.         $mipdf ->load_html(utf8_decode($html));
  18.          
  19.         # Renderizamos el documento PDF.
  20.         $mipdf ->render();
  21.          
  22.         # Enviamos el fichero PDF al navegador.
  23.         $mipdf ->stream('FicheroEjemplo.pdf');
  24.         }

Etiquetas: Ninguno
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 06:37.